次の方法で共有


CAtlList::GetAt

リスト内の指定された位置に格納されている要素を返します。

E& GetAt(
   POSITION pos 
) throw( );
const E& GetAt(
   POSITION pos 
) const throw( );

パラメーター

  • pos
    特定の要素を指定する POSITION 値。

戻り値

要素への参照または要素のコピーを返します。

解説

リストが const の場合、GetAt は要素のコピーを返します。 このとき、このメソッドは代入ステートメントの右辺にしか使えないので、リストは変更されません。

リストが const 以外の場合は、GetAt は要素への参照を返します。 このとき、このメソッドは代入ステートメントの右辺にも左辺にも使用できるので、リストのエントリを変更できます。

デバッグ ビルドでは、pos が NULL である場合にアサーション エラーが発生します。

使用例

CAtlList::FindIndex」の例を参照してください。

必要条件

**ヘッダー:**atlcoll.h

参照

参照

CAtlList クラス

CAtlList::FindIndex

その他の技術情報

CAtlList のメンバー